personally, i live in rural northeast ohio......and this was my first winter with the gs and first winter ever having to deal with driving in snow. this year was a record snow year, i got all season tires, and i just hit the snow mode and took it VERY easy; the guys at the dealership in cols said that they were sure i'd need snow tires with the GS in a city, let alone out in the boonies where i am. but i had no problems whatsoever besides an occasional spinning wheel. and this is actually a hilly area of ohio, which would seem to have made things worse.
